Hey Everyone,

With the #PJTrackReveal, new album around the bend and the new "Audio Chronicles" (here: http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=yhN8wn7wEok) I was wondering if anyone had, or knows where to find the recently used fonts' The one used for the Lightning Bolt artwork has a skinny, straight line feel to it much like the Century Gothic used for the 2006 world bootlegs but the corners and bends are far more rounded. I can't find it anywhere. I also can't find anything that looks like Jeff's handwriting (like on the right side of the screen in the video above). I know this is Jeff's actual writing but perhaps with all the samples over the years and the many, many things he's written that the band has released, maybe someone with the expertise has created a font for it.

Anyways, if anyone has any leads on where someone could acquire these fonts, please let me know. Thanks a lot in advance. :)
